The PSAT is a test that evaluates reading, writing and math skills and lasts 2 hours and 45 minutes. Most of the questions are multiple choice. The reading part lasts 60 minute, writing & language 35 minutes and math 70 minutes. The evidence-based reading section presents passages from different topics that are challenging and it evaluates reasoning and comprehesion skills.
